These forms of meditation,therefore, can at best take the aspirantvery close to self-knowledge which can only dawn in its full glorywhen the domain of the mind is completely traversed. Someimpersonal forms of specialised meditation are therefore concernedwith mental operations, and they ultimately aim at stilling themind.To acquire control over thoughts is to become fullyconscious of what they are. They have to be attended to beforethey are controlled. In ordinary introspection it is seldom possibleWriting downthoughtsfor the beginner to devote adequate attention to allthe shadowy thoughts which pass through hismind. It is helpful, therefore, for the aspirantoccasionally to write down all his thoughts 6 as they come and thento inspect them carefully at leisure. This process is different fromwriting planned articles. Thoughts are allowed to arise without anydirection or restraint so that even repressed elements from thesubconscious mind have access to the conscious mind.In a more advanced stage, an intensive awareness of mentalprocesses can take place while thoughts appear in consciousness,and writing them down becomes unnecessary. Observation ofWatching mentaloperationsmental operations 7 should be accompanied bycritical evaluation of thoughts. Thoughtscannot be controlled except through anappreciation of their value or lack of value.
